Dimanche and Other Stories

A never-before-translated collection by the bestselling author of Suite Fran?aiseWritten between 1934 and 1942, these ten gem-like stories mine the same terrain of N?mirovsky's bestselling novel Suite Fran?aise: a keen eye for the details of social class; the tensions between mothers and daughters, husbands and wives; the manners and mannerisms of the French bourgeoisie; questions of religion and personal identity. Moving from the drawing rooms of pre-war Paris to the lives of men and women in wartime France, here we find the beautiful work of a writer at the height of her tragically short career.From the Trade Paperback edition.
